About this role
Role Overview
Own and deliver national business performance across the Metabolics portfolio
Develop and execute product business plans aligned to national strategy
Analyze market trends, competitive dynamics, and performance data to inform actions
Lead, coach, and develop first-line leaders to maximize team effectiveness
Build a strong leadership pipeline and succession plans
Foster a culture of accountability, engagement, and continuous improvement
Ensure consistent and high-quality execution of brand strategy in the field
Monitor KPIs and drive disciplined performance management
Identify and scale best practices across regions
Partner with Marketing, Market Access, Medical Affairs, Patient Services and Operations
Ensure alignment of strategy and coordinated execution
Provide field insights to inform brand planning and lifecycle strategy
Maintain strategic relationships with key opinion leaders (KOLs) and top accounts
Understand regional nuances in referral patterns and treatment pathways
Support teams in navigating complex access and reimbursement environments
Ensure all activities comply with regulatory, legal, and company policies
Model integrity and patient-first decision making
Reinforce a culture of compliance across the organization
Requirements
Bachelor’s degree required; MBA or advanced degree preferred
Minimum 7 years pharmaceutical/biotech experience, with 5+ years of leadership experience
Successful experience leading leaders (second-line leadership) highly desired
Significant rare disease and/or specialty experience
Proven success in product launches, ideally with first-in-class therapies and in competitive markets
Demonstrated ability to build, lead, train and develop high-performing teams
Proven success in sales leadership roles with the ability to inspire, influence and align teams
Experience navigating complex rare disease patient journeys, including diagnosis, referral pathways, and difficult access to therapies
Strong leadership presence with the ability to inspire, influence, and align teams
Strong understanding of market access, payer dynamics, and patient services
Demonstrated ability to lead in a matrixed organization
High integrity, ethical standards, and commitment to compliance
Thrives in a fast-paced, dynamic, and collaborative environment
Able to travel frequently, up to 60% overnight travel and has a valid drivers’ license
